Job 21:11 New English Translation
11 They allow their children to run[a] like a flock;
their little ones dance about.
Footnotes
- Job 21:11 tn The verb שָׁלַח (shalakh) means “to send forth,” but in the Piel “to release; to allow to run free.” The picture of children frolicking in the fields and singing and dancing is symbolic of peaceful, prosperous times.
